How our AI helps you test?
Note: To use Automated Testing, make sure "AI features for metadata" is enabled on your Feature access page.
Our product leverages artificial intelligence to address the most frustrating parts of UI testing:
Generating tests: Instead of writing complex scripts, you can use simple plain English prompts to create test steps. Our AI understands your intent and translates it into a working test, saving you time.
Generating steps with clicks: We record your clicks and translate them to plain English steps. This helps make your tests repeatable, even when the underlying layout/style changes.
Intelligent fallbacks: The AI can detect if it cannot reach its goal (i.e. validation errors) and will attempt to fix it. For example, a validation error when you save an object. It will detect and retry with the right format.
What can it do right now?
Saved tests: Easily create new test cases and save them for future use. You can use both:
AI Agent: Use our AI agent to create a set of steps and assertions from a prompt.
Recorder: Record clicks in the live browser view and they are translated into steps. Note: Our Gearset Agent helps generate assertions or checks for the test.
Switch User: Create tests as your end users to capture any missing fields, buttons etc.
Execute & Rerun: Run tests instantly and re-run them whenever you need to. Get immediate feedback on whether a test passes or fails.
What we are working on?
Scheduled test jobs: Run all tests in one go, on a weekly or daily schedule
Jira/Azure DevOps integration: Create or link to Jira or Azure DevOps from a test result, so you can fix issues or link results transparently on your ticketing system.
Pipeline integration: Executing and seeing the UI Test results in Pipelines.
What we are not doing yet?
We're starting small and focusing on the core experience. That means we're not including features like:
Ingesting large existing test scripts (written or from other UI testing tools)
Full integrations with other tools
We want to get the fundamentals right and focus on the highest priority problems first. It doesn’t mean we’re not going to work on these things, we're just not working on them yet.
